On this day in RUSH History ... 11 February 1991
After 17+ years of using Pro-Mark Rock-747s, Mr. Neil Peart agrees to an official endorsment arrangement with Pro-Mark drumsticks and becomes the newest member of the Pro-Mark Family.
Today is the 15th Anniversary of Neil joining the Pro-Mark Family.
